    @adsoyad2607 2 года назад +4

    I'm not a traffic design expert or anything but the traffic lights being on the other side of the street seems to create more visibility problems than there really has to be. Is this a US/Canada thing only or is it common throughout the world? Where I live all traffic lights at intersections are on the same side of the road as you so them being on the opposite side is very counter-intuitive to me

    • @adsoyad2607
      @adsoyad2607 2 года назад

      i guess one advantage of traffic lights being on the far side is that you don't have to crane your neck to see the light when you stop too close to the stop line. but when there's a big vehicle in front of you the visibility is superior with lights on the near side

    • @ConduiteFacile
      @ConduiteFacile  2 года назад +1

      I don't know if it's specific to North America, bud I've given some lessons to immigrants that were confused by that. The first few times they drove here, they would have stopped in the middle of the intersection had I not braked them. The example that you give about being too close to the light to see it properly is a good one. The ideal would be to have them at both places, but that would double the city's budget for traffic lights.

    I got into an accident yesterday, and I have a question that I am very embarrassed to ask: is there a way to know sure if I will doze off, as opposed to knowing that I am just feeling sleepy? I dozed off while driving, and swerved into the other side of the road and then crashed. :(

    • @ConduiteFacile
      @ConduiteFacile  2 года назад +1

      As soon as you feel sleepy, there's a big risk that you'll doze off. And most of the time you won't see it coming. We always think that we'll fend off the sleep. That tends to happen especially when you're stopped (at a red light for example) but really it can happen anywhere. As soon as you feel sleepy, stop driving. If you feel sleepy BEFORE driving, don't. It's as dangerous as driving drunk or texting.

    Is it normal to cross/turn a solid yellow line when entering or exiting some locations (like hospital's, stores, etc) as per google maps lots of directions mention to 'turn' while crossing it?

    • @ConduiteFacile
      @ConduiteFacile  Год назад +1

      Here in Quebec, it's legal to go from public to private, but not the other way around. So for example, if you want to go into a gas station from the street, you can cross the solid line. But when you exit the gas station, you can't cross the solid line to go into the street.
